Chocolate


Oh they're out in the sunshine
Wandering through the trees
Picking the cocoa
In ones and twos and threes:

Oh they take this little bean
And they grind it and mix it
Stir it and turn it
And when it's done they fix it.
And they very carefully
Making sure there's no waste
Turn it into a creamy brown
Liquid runny little paste.

Then they take all these flavours
Some soft some hard, all sweet
And they pat them and shape them
To make them all look neat

They take the liquid beans
And as the shapes pass down a line
Pour it all over them
And it sets with a shine
And they pack them
All neatly in a pretty carton
And fix the box lid on

So we have a box of chocolates
A selection made to delight
That we can eat watching telly
On a warm and cosy winter night
